Dale McKinney

Job Titles:
  • Partner / Real Estate Attorney
Dale McKinney is a lifelong resident of Greenville who entered law school after working in the business world for eight years. Dale has focused his practice on real estate closings since he began practicing law in 2000. Dale believes his role as a real estate attorney involves giving individual attention to every one of his clients and strives to be just a phone call or e-mail away from his clients. If you call Dale don't be surprised if he answers the phone, even after hours. Dale is a graduate of the University of South Carolina, where he was a member of Chi Psi fraternity and worked in the South Carolina State Senate. He received his Juris Doctor Degree from the University of South Carolina School of Law. He has been married to his wife, Melissa, for over 25 years and they have one son, Logan. When not handling real estate closings Dale enjoys college football and baseball, spending time at the beach, relaxing by his koi pond and occasionally playing golf.

Henry Sullivan

Job Titles:
  • Partner / Real Estate Attorney
  • Services / Residential Real Estate
Henry Sullivan has lived in Greenville most of his life, with deep family roots in Anderson, Greenville and Laurens. Henry began the practice of law in 1987 with the law firm of Leatherwood, Walker, Todd and Mann in Greenville, where he was a trial lawyer and also handled business and corporate matters before opening up his own business as a real estate attorney. During law school Henry worked with several real estate law firms, and after practicing law in Greenville for five years with Leatherwood, Walker, Todd and Mann, and another four years with Ashmore, Rabon & Sullivan, P.A., in 1996 Henry opened his own office, focusing on residential real estate and commercial real estate closings. Henry has primarily handled real estate closings since that time and believes in providing professional and quality legal representation to his clients on each and every closing or legal matter. Henry is a graduate of the University of South Carolina, where he was a member of Sigma Alpha Epsilon fraternity, and he also graduated from the University of South Carolina law school. He has been married to his wife, Douglas, for over 25 years and they have two children, Katy and Henry. When not practicing law Henry enjoys Gamecock football and baseball, spending time at the lake or the beach, and occasionally hunting and fishing.
